Japanese Dance Group Uses Optical Illusions To Blow The Judges Away!

Siro-A is a Japanese dance group specializing in creative dance utilizing video. And their incredible audition on America’s Got Talent had every single judge on the edge of their seat. What an amazing performance from this talented group!

